Troubleshooting Switching Power Converters—A Hands-on Guide

 


 

Troubleshooting Switching Power Converters: A Hands-on Guide

by Sanjaya Maniktala 

2008 (318 pages)

ISBN:9780750684217

Intended to be the senior engineer's "bag of tricks," this easy-to-read book will make life for the ambitious power supply engineer much simpler, and will significantly reduce the rigorous requirement of having to be a senior engineer's protégé for years.
